1089 providers in Advanced Heart Failure & Transplant (AHFT), Critical Care Medicine, Hematology, Neuropathology, Telehealth Services

1089 providers in Advanced Heart Failure & Transplant (AHFT), Critical Care Medicine, Hematology, Neuropathology, Telehealth Services